First three rows from subquery
<source lang="sql">
SQL> SQL> create table history
2 ( empno NUMBER(4) 3 , beginyear NUMBER(4) 4 , begindate DATE 5 , enddate DATE 6 , deptno NUMBER(2) 7 , sal NUMBER(6,2) 8 , comments VARCHAR2(60) 9 , constraint H_PK primary key (empno,begindate) 10 , constraint H_BEG_END check (begindate < enddate) 11 ) ;
Table created. SQL> SQL> SQL> alter session set NLS_DATE_FORMAT="DD-MM-YYYY"; Session altered. SQL> SQL> insert into history values (1,2000,"01-02-2000", NULL ,20, 800,"restarted"); 1 row created. SQL> insert into history values (2,1995,"01-10-1995","01-11-2009",30,1700,""); 1 row created. SQL> insert into history values (2,2009,"01-11-2009", NULL ,30,1600,"just hired"); 1 row created. SQL> insert into history values (3,1986,"01-10-1986","01-08-1987",20,1000,""); 1 row created. SQL> insert into history values (3,1987,"01-08-1987","01-01-1989",30,1000,"On training"); 1 row created. SQL> insert into history values (3,2000,"01-02-2000", NULL ,30,1250,""); 1 row created. SQL> SQL> select *
2 from (select empno, sal 3 from history 4 order by sal desc) 5 where rownum <= 3; EMPNO SAL
----------
2 1700 2 1600 3 1250
SQL> SQL> drop table history; Table dropped. SQL>

Format result from subquery
<source lang="sql">
SQL> SQL> SQL> select username,
2 to_number( substr( data, 1, 10 ) ) cnt, 3 to_number( substr( data, 11 ) ) avg 4 from ( 5 select a.username, (select to_char( count(*), "fm0000000009" ) || avg(object_id) from all_objects b where b.owner = a.username) data 6 from all_users a 7 ) 8 /
USERNAME CNT AVG
---------- ----------
SYS 6520 5009.74064 SYSTEM 422 6095.87678 OUTLN 7 1172.57143 DIP 0 TSMSYS 2 8606.5 INV15 2 16237.5 DBSNMP 46 9592.65217 INV10 2 16227.5 CTXSYS 338 9877.92012 XDB 334 10800.7485 ANONYMOUS 0 USERNAME CNT AVG
---------- ----------
MDSYS 458 11667.2009 HR 34 12104.5 FLOWS_FILES 11 12717.2727 FLOWS_020100 1085 12813.424 sqle 530 16254.6849 INV11 2 16229.5 INV12 2 16231.5 INV13 2 16233.5 INV14 2 16235.5 PLSQL 0 INV16 2 16239.5 USERNAME CNT AVG
---------- ----------
INV17 2 16241.5 INV18 2 16243.5 INV19 2 16245.5 INV20 2 16247.5 DEFINER 4 16250.5 27 rows selected. SQL>
